A nurse is preparing to administer medications to a 5-month-old infant.
Drag 1 medication and 1 infant finding to fill in each blank in the following sentence. The nurse should clarify the prescription for
The Correct Answer is {"dropdown-group-1":"D","dropdown-group-2":"E"}
Medication (Ceftriaxone): Given the infant's history of amoxicillin allergy, there is a potential cross-reactivity concern with cephalosporins like ceftriaxone. It's crucial to clarify the allergy details and assess for any potential allergic reactions before administering.
Finding (Allergy): The infant has a documented allergy to amoxicillin, which raises concerns about potential cross-reactivity with cephalosporins, including ceftriaxone. Clarifying the allergy details ensures safe administration and prevents adverse reactions.

To calculate the dosage of ibuprofen in milliliters for a 24-hour period, we start by determining the total milligrams required per day. Since the prescription is for 200 mg every 8 hours, the child will need three doses in 24 hours (200 mg x 3 = 600 mg). Next, we convert the total milligrams into milliliters using the concentration provided. The formula is: (Total mg needed / Concentration of mg) x Volume of each concentration = Total mL. Plugging in the numbers: (600 mg / 100 mg) x 5 mL = 30 mL.

A. Nasal discharge negative for glucose indicates that there is no c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) leakage, which is a positive sign. While it is important to note, it is not the priority in this situation.
B. A negative Babinski reflex is a normal finding in children older than 2 years. It does not indicate an acute issue and is not the priority.
C. Asymmetric pupils can be a sign of increased intracranial pressure or a serious brain injury, making this the priority finding. It requires immediate attention to prevent further complications.
D. A 2 cm scalp laceration, while needing medical attention, is not life-threatening and is not the highest priority compared to potential brain injury indicated by asymmetric pupils.
